色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

$_get在php

洪振霞1年前8瀏覽0評論

在 PHP 中,通過 HTTP GET 方法傳遞數據時,使用超全局變量 $_GET 可以輕松獲取 URL 參數數據。$_GET 變量是一個數組,它的鍵和值由 URL 中的查詢字符串決定,其中鍵表示參數名,值表示參數值。

例如,如果 URL 為 https://example.com?name=Bob&age=25,則可以通過以下代碼獲取查詢字符串中的參數:

$name = $_GET['name'];
$age = $_GET['age'];

$_GET 變量也可用于接收多個參數。例如,以下 URL 包含兩個參數:

https://example.com?subject=math&score=90

可以使用以下代碼來獲取它們:

$subject = $_GET['subject'];
$score = $_GET['score'];

需要注意的是,使用 $_GET 變量獲取參數時需要注意安全性。不同于 $_POST 方法,GET 方法的參數是公開可見的,可能會被惡意用戶用于攻擊。因此,在使用 $_GET 時,需要對參數進行有效性檢查和必要的過濾,避免可能的安全漏洞。

另外,對于 URL 參數中含有特殊字符的情況,需要用 urlencode() 進行編碼,以確保參數不會被誤解析。例如,以下 URL 包含一個包含空格的參數:

https://example.com?name=John Doe

使用以下代碼,可以在獲取參數時將空格轉換為加號:

$name = str_replace('+', ' ', urlencode($_GET['name']));

最后,需要注意的是,$_GET 變量只能獲取 GET 方法傳遞的參數,不能接收 POST 方法的參數。如果需要獲取 POST 方法傳遞的參數,則需要使用 $_POST 變量。